The main differences between saltine cracker and matzo
- Saltine cracker is richer in iron, folate, vitamin B2, vitamin B3, vitamin B1, and copper, yet matzo is richer in selenium.
- Daily need coverage for iron for saltine cracker is 57% higher.
Food types used in this article are Crackers, saltines, fat-free, low-sodium and Crackers, matzo, plain.
